crypt of decay - WTFPL'ed Z80 Emulation Core [entries|archive|friends|userinfo]
ketmar

[ userinfo | ljr userinfo ]
[ archive | journal archive ]

WTFPL'ed Z80 Emulation Core [Jul. 29th, 2012|06:52 pm]
Previous Entry Add to Memories Tell A Friend Next Entry
Zymosis.

кажется, первый в интернетах, который под WTFPL, при этом чистый си и — что важнее всего — эмулирует Z80 полностью, включая недокументированые команды и MEMPTR. также оно сделано ручками, а не генерируется из таблиц, поэтому маленькое, не требует скриптов генерации и совершенно ужасно внутри (особенно в части декодирования команд, которое — подозреваю — похоже на то, как это делает сам Z80).

проходит все доступные мне тесты, отлично работает в собраном «на коленке» эмуляторе ZX Spectrum. включая корректную эмуляцию contended memory, contended ports, ULA floating bus effect — а сие значит, что растактовка команд тоже верная.

в общем, можете смело проходить мимо, вам всё это не надо.
Linkmeow!

Comments:
From:(Anonymous)
Date:July 29th, 2012 - 09:33 pm
(Link)
> в общем, можете смело проходить мимо, вам всё это не надо.

кейт, ну хватит выпячивать свой непризнанный гений :)
[User Picture]
From:[info]ketmar
Date:July 29th, 2012 - 09:45 pm
(Link)
почему? моя днявочка — чем хочу, тем и махаю.
From:(Anonymous)
Date:July 29th, 2012 - 11:10 pm
(Link)
ну не знаю. возможно сугубо личное, но отчитывается как слабость. мерско.
[User Picture]
From:[info]ketmar
Date:July 29th, 2012 - 11:13 pm
(Link)
(пожимает плечами) why should i care?
From:(Anonymous)
Date:July 29th, 2012 - 11:23 pm
(Link)
абсолютно не обязан, да.
[User Picture]
From:[info]steinkrauz
Date:July 30th, 2012 - 07:23 am
(Link)
RANDOMIZE USR 0!
[User Picture]
From:[info]aiveforever
Date:July 30th, 2012 - 05:18 pm
(Link)
в каментах ниче не понял, пост не читал, но в Карелии ня))
------
а в рсс тебя много 5-)
From:(Anonymous)
Date:August 1st, 2012 - 01:20 pm

Спектрум говно же

(Link)
Только амига! Только Сабрина хардкор!